Terms of Service for To-Go

Last updated: April 18, 2025

1. INTRODUCTION


This mobile application and ordering website ("Service") is provided by To-Go ApS ("To-Go") and allows you to purchase items from selected cafés, restaurants, and other takeaway places ("Restaurant"). These terms of use ("Terms") apply to your use of the Service, including your registration, ordering, and payment through the Service.


1.1 Commercial Agent

When you purchase products through the Service, To-Go acts as a commercial agent on behalf of the Restaurant. To-Go is authorized to enter into purchase agreements on behalf of the Restaurant. Thus, the purchase agreement is concluded directly between you and the Restaurant, and To-Go is not a party to that agreement. To-Go is also authorized to receive payment on behalf of the Restaurant. Your payment obligation is considered fulfilled once payment is made to To-Go.


1.2 Agreement Conclusion

A completed order through the Service constitutes a binding offer to the Restaurant. The agreement is only finalized once the Restaurant accepts the order.

3. PAYMENT AND DELIVERY CONDITIONS


You must pay using a payment card accepted by the Service. Payment information is stored securely on a PCI-certified server. Upon pickup or delivery of goods, you may be required to present your order number. You are responsible for protecting your information and devices. To-Go encrypts data between the Service and its server but is not liable for misuse resulting from your negligence. Any delivery times stated by the Restaurant are indicative and not binding.

Handling fee: To-Go may charge a small handling fee per order. This will be clearly displayed before you complete your purchase.

4. DURATION AND CHANGES


These Terms remain in effect while you use the Service. Certain provisions, such as liability disclaimers and data protection, continue even after use ends.

Modifying or canceling orders: You can modify or cancel your order through the Service until the Restaurant accepts it.

Order rejection: The Restaurant may reject your order, e.g., if a product is no longer available.

Refunds: For canceled or rejected orders, the reserved amount will be released back to your account. This may take up to 7 days depending on your bank.

10. GOVERNING LAW AND DISPUTE RESOLUTION


These Terms are governed by Danish law. Disputes must be resolved through the Danish courts unless mandatory consumer protection rules specify otherwise.

11. COMPLAINTS, CANCELLATIONS, AND DISPUTES


Complaints: The Danish Sale of Goods Act applies. If your items are damaged or incorrect, you must file a complaint as soon as possible.

Right of cancellation: You have a 14-day right of cancellation, but this does not apply to perishable goods such as food and drinks.

Complaints procedure: If you are dissatisfied with your order, first contact the Restaurant. If unresolved, you may contact To-Go or file a complaint through one of the following:

  • The Danish Consumer Complaints Board (www.forbrug.dk)
  • European Commission Online Dispute Resolution (www.ec.europa.eu/consumers/odr)
  • The Board of Appeal for Hotel, Restaurant and Tourism (www.hrt-ankenaevn.dk)
